The secret of a successful courier service business is providing services not available from the bigger firms like fedex and ups, such as local, same-day service, or finding a profitable niche, like medical specimen deliveries.

In addition to a growing population, there are more customers who require faster service, ranging from “stat” medical specimen deliveries to time-sensitive legal documents to “just-in-time” parts deliveries to local manufacturers.
